Deep Maroon vs Tradewind paint color comparison

Deep Maroon vs Tradewind

Deep MaroonSherwin-WilliamsvsTradewindSherwin-WilliamsΔE 55.5Very different colors

Both from Sherwin-Williams's palette. Deep Maroon reads as pink, while Tradewind reads as blue-grey — two distinct hue families, not close cousins. Tradewind (LRV 61) reflects noticeably more light than Deep Maroon (LRV 7), a difference of 54 points that becomes especially apparent in rooms with limited natural light. Deep Maroon runs warm while Tradewind is decidedly cool, which means they'll respond very differently to warm vs cool light sources. With a ΔE of 55.5, the contrast is hard to miss. These aren't variations on a theme — they're two different answers to the same question.
